How long does bankruptcy last in Australia?

Ask a Building & Construction lawyer in Voyager Point

Bankruptcy usually lasts for three years and one day from the date it is declared.;In some cases, the bankruptcy period can be extended up to eight years if the trustee determines misconduct.

How can a contract be terminated legally?

Ask a Building & Construction lawyer in Voyager Point

A contract can be terminated legally by mutual agreement, performance, breach, or frustration.;Termination clauses in the contract itself can also dictate the conditions under which a contract can be ended.
